Default 2001 Cbr929rr tail light wiring trouble

I'm having a lot of trouble getting my tail light to even work on my bike, all the wires that are supposed to have power do but I can't figure out why it won't work. When I purchased the bike the wires for the tail were all chopped. The tail light might be bad or there might be a grounding issue with the wiring harness. I have looked up the wiring diagrams and know which wires should be hooked up. Like the brown and white should power the brake light but there's 3 different B&W wires and there's 2 green and white which are supposed to power the running light. Kinda lost, my next step is to try grounding it to the bikes frame, if that doesn't work I'm going to order a new tail light. Any insight you guys have will help for sure
